Description
A sweet and savory vegetarian dish featuring grilled halloumi cheese and butternut squash skewers, glazed with a maple and herb mixture for a deliciously charred finish.
Ingredients
Scale
For the Crust:
- 1 small butternut squash, peeled and cubed
- 8 oz halloumi cheese, cut into cubes
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 2 tbsp maple syrup
- 1 tsp smoked paprika
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h thyme sprigs for garnish
- Wooden or metal skewers
Instructions
1. Prepare the Crust:
- Preheat grill or grill pan to medium-high heat. If using wooden skewers, soak in water for 30 minutes to prevent burning.
- In a bowl, toss butternut squash cubes with 1 tbsp olive oil, salt, and pepper. Thread alternating pieces of squash and halloumi onto skewers.
- In a small bowl, mix maple syrup, remaining olive oil, smoked paprika, and garlic powder. Brush the glaze generously over the skewers.
- Grill skewers for 8-10 minutes, turning occasionally, until squash is tender and halloumi is golden with grill marks.
- Remove from grill, garnish with fresh thyme, and serve immediately.
